2024.05.20 01:28 Mysterious-Okra-7885 HOTH! I just finished this Kria Shawl for my mom!

HOTH! I just finished this Kria Shawl for my mom!
This is the Kria Shawl pattern by Tinna Thorudottir Thorvaldar. I just left off the tassels.
I used Scheepjes Whirl in Petrol Please Me and a 3.25mm hook.
This is an excellent pattern for mindless crochet or car crochet because it is just a 2- row repeat once you get the starting rows established.

2024.05.19 23:02 EmoRyloKenn The trouble with treble crochet

The trouble with treble crochet
I am designing a top and really like the way the repeat looks and I am excited to keep going. The trouble is I am using a lot of treble crochets. I have done them before in the past with absolutely no issue, but for some reason with this specific pattern, I am struggling with them! Can anyone help?
For example: Row 2 is 3 dc, ch3, sk 2 st, (tc, sk st)x3, tc, ch3, sk 2 st, 3dc and so on
Every time I do a tc, the yarn is not gliding through the loops as they do when I’m working chains or dcs. It is “catching” on my hook and screws up the tension. It is really frustrating because it slows down the progress and makes it unenjoyable. Previously I have done a complicated top with a lot of tcs and never had this issue. It was quick to work up and the yarn glided just fine. I am using the same yarn, different color. It is 50% cotton, 50% acrylic. Hook size is 4.5mm. I tried with 2 other different yarns and the tcs were catching on the hook too.
Does anyone know what might be happening? I don’t even know what to google.
